  3. The Airport Express Line or Orange Line is a Delhi Metro line from New Delhi to Yashobhoomi Dwarka Sector - 25, linking Indira Gandhi International Airport. The total length of the line is 22.7 km (14.1 mi), [2] of which 15.7 km (9.8 mi) is underground [3] and 7.0 km (4.3 mi), from Buddha Jayanti Park to Mahipalpur, elevated.

  5. The Delhi Airport Metro Express Line of Delhi Metro runs between New Delhi Metro Station to Dwarka Sector 21. Also known as the Orange Line, the total length of this line is 22.7 Km. The trains travel at up to 135 km/h, instead of up to 80 km/h as on the rest of the metro.
